Washington County Career Center-Adult Technical Training vs. Paul Mitchell the School-Cincinnati
Both Washington County Career Center-Adult Technical Training and Paul Mitchell the School-Cincinnati are Less than 2 years schools located in Ohio. The following statements compare Washington County Career Center-Adult Technical Training and Paul Mitchell the School-Cincinnati with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Paul Mitchell the School-Cincinnati's tuition ($18,915) is more expensive than Washington County Career Center-Adult Technical Training ($5,020).
- Washington County Career Center-Adult Technical Training's students to faculty ratio (5 to 1) is lower than Paul Mitchell the School-Cincinnati (13 to 1).
- Paul Mitchell the School-Cincinnati (246 students) is larger than Washington County Career Center-Adult Technical Training (193 students) with more enrolled students.
- Paul Mitchell the School-Cincinnati ($6,008) has higher amount of financial aid than Washington County Career Center-Adult Technical Training ($3,373).
- Both schools have same graduation rate of 79%.
